Role: Graduate or Junior Buyer / procurement specialist

Sector: Electronics and manufacturing

Location: Swindon

Salary: £25,000 - £35,000

General Description:

  • Chase suppliers for delivery dates.
  • Request quotations for cable, connectors, and other components.
  • Raise purchase orders.
  • Update delivery schedules.
  • Help manage shortages and stock levels.
  • Support senior buyers with supplier negotiations and sourcing activities.

You will keep production supplied, suppliers accountable and stakeholders informed, playing a key part in keeping customer commitments on track. The Buyer will be responsible for interpreting and communicating technical specifications from design engineers to suppliers. Additionally, the buyer will be responsible for ensuring sub-contract suppliers are selected and developed to meet all material delivery milestones. You will be sourcing both nationally and internationally, negotiating with new and existing suppliers. This role requires strong analytical skills, excellent communication, and the ability to work collaboratively with various departments. This is a pivotal role in the company’s transition from an R&D house developing concepts and prototypes, to one of delivering high revenue growth through the sale of mature and effective products.

Responsibilities:

  • You will manage the full purchasing cycle, from raising purchase orders through to goods arriving on site, keeping a close eye on delivery schedules and chasing suppliers where needed to protect production timelines.
  • When orders slip, you'll step in quickly to expedite, troubleshoot and find workarounds that keep disruption to a minimum.
  • Accuracy matters in this role. You'll be responsible for keeping the ERP system (CIM50 / Sage) up to date across purchasing records, costs and stock levels, ensuring the business always has reliable data to work from.
  • Supplier relationships will be a big part of your week. You'll be in regular contact on pricing, lead times and order progress, and you'll support wider sourcing activity by identifying alternative suppliers and gathering quotations when the situation calls for it.
  • This is a highly collaborative position. You'll work hand in hand with engineering, production and sales colleagues to make sure purchasing decisions reflect real operational priorities, and you'll be encouraged to bring ideas, whether that's introducing simple tracking tools to improve visibility of urgent requirements or finding smarter ways to cut delays.

Prepare for Behavioural Questions

Entry-level roles often focus on your potential rather than extensive experience. Get ready for behavioural questions that explore how you handle teamwork or problem-solving.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to structure your responses and relate them back to any group projects or internships you've done.
